Center for EU Education and Youth Programs that work as an institution of Prime Ministry State Planning Organization is responsible form the implementing, financing and generalizing Education and Youth Programs that are in the scope of the EU Community Programs. Turkey, which is among 31 countries with full participation to the programs, is the 7th country that has the largest budget in terms of the grants being distributed.
Lifelong Learning Program (LLP) that contains all the activities about education aims to create an information society, provide more and better employment opportunities, develop social cohesion, strengthen exchange, cooperation and mobility among the education systems in the society in order to provide protection of the environment for the next generation through lifelong learning.
